Household Details

The area's household landscape is diverse, with 42% owner-occupied homes and 58% renter-occupied properties. Family households represent 69% of the population, indicating a strong community focus on family living. The average home value stands at $560,506, which suggests ample demand for multi-bedroom properties.

Racial Diversity

The area's community showcases a dynamic blend of cultures, contributing to a rich and inclusive environment. Demographic data highlights a diverse composition, with 2% Asian, 55% Black, and 0% Native residents, alongside 16% White and 30% Hispanic/Other populations. This multicultural landscape offers residents a vibrant and culturally enriched living experience.

Income

The area reflects a well-distributed income pattern with approximately 17% of households earning over $100,000 annually, while 34% fall within the $50,000 to $100,000 range. The median income stands at $75,000, signalling a financially stable community with growth potential.
